WARNING: Fake Twitter Account that impersonates Cryptopia
(I know there has been a lot of warnings about this, but this account can really fool some of Cryptopia users.)

Uses same Name, Profile Picture, Banner (it's not in good quality). The only difference in username is that it uses 2 underscores and an extra i which might be missed at first glance.
Code:
@Cryptiopia__NZ
https://twitter.com/Cryptiopia__NZ

It also retweets the tweets from the Official twitter account of Cryptopia:



And actively replying to Cryptopia users who are replying on Official Cryptopia Account tweets:





I've reported the account on Twitter (selected "They’re pretending to be me or someone else" as issue). If you still see the account, please report it too and provide the Official username of Cryptopia. Thanks!

What we know so far:

Code:
14.0489% BTC was lost in the January 2019 event
100% ETH was lost in the January 2019 event.
43.1986% LTC was lost in the January 2019 event
Every account that held these received a proportional reduction of balance.

It's an "event"?! The same lack of taking responsibility as was displayed from the very beginning.

And, of course,
Quote
CLM is not a coin, it can't be traded as yet, it is just a number in the database that represents the loss for each coin for each user in $NZD at the time of the event.
1CLM = 1 $NZD. The value in fiat at the market low. But we did not have fiat funds. We had crypto. We should get crypto back.

The funds were in Cryptopia custody, so Cryptopia is responsible for the loss. Not the users.
